BeatO partners with Saksham to assist 100 children manage their Type 1 diabetes

New Delhi: Digital health platform for diabetes management, BeatO today announced its collaboration with Saksham, a charitable trust which assists individuals with Type 1 Diabetes thereby providing them with regular information, motivation and support for diabetes management.

BeatO is collaborating with Saksham to adopt 100 children with Type 1 diabetes by the end of FY’21. BeatO will assist children with diabetes management tools to be able to control their blood-sugar levels more efficiently. These tools include complimentary access to BeatO’s smartphone glucometer and feature-rich BeatO app. BeatO will also provide its technology dashboard to Saksham’s diabetes educators to timely manage and proactively intervene based on the children’s sugar readings taken through HealthNeuronTM, BeatO’s AI triaging system. Further, BeatO is also educating their parents on effectively helping their children manage Type 1 diabetes.

Incepted under the guidance of Endocrinologist Dr. Beena Bansal (Ex-Director of Division of Endocrinology, Medanta), Saksham’s support team educates and enables individuals with Type 1 diabetes, as well as their caregivers to face life challenges with strength and intellect.

Given the social stigma associated with diabetes, especially in young children, this support will help the children manage their condition better, and hence respond to social situations and their environment more effectively.

This partnership aims to extend technological support for self-management of diabetes, a chronic condition which requires constant commitment and care by the patient and their caretakers equally.

Through BeatO’s HealthNeuronTM system, BeatO is able to monitor people with Diabetes real time, and provide timely triggers for proactive intervention through specialists as soon as the system senses a need for this intervention. A recent research study by BeatO on the effects of counselling by diabetes educators showed a significant improvement of 9.45% on fasting sugar levels and PP levels along with a large number of users being able to shift their sugar reading range to safe, normal range. In addition, a sharp reduction in Hypoglycemia episodes was seen and this is extremely relevant for people with Type 1 Diabetes.
